Fashion houses host annual cruise shows to charm their global audiences who travel around the world to sunny destinations, so why did a French fashion brand choose Scotland? 

It seems the Parisian brand has been heavily influenced by the infamous tartan pattern from the highlands which is why it chose Scotland to host the 2025 show. Creative director and fashion designer Maria Grazia Chiuri embraced the Scottish design and showcased tartan dresses in shades of yellow and violet along with leather looks inspired by Mary Queen of Scots. 

As well as the founder Christian Dior having a special bond with Scotland, the new collection may have also been influenced by the ‘Le Kilt’ fashion designer Samantha McCoach who was brought in by Maria Grazia Chiuri to collaborate and help create the new range.
